You're listening to Catholic Sprouts, the daily podcast for Catholic kids that strives to plant seeds of faith.

0:14.4

Hey there, Spouts. Today is Thursday, February 14th, 2019.

0:24.6

This week on the Catholic Sprouts podcast, we are talking about purity.

0:28.3

We started by talking about our Lady of Lords in St. Bernadette.

0:32.0

Then we reflected on our own pristine baptismal gown and how we need to quest to keep it perfectly clean and to keep our

0:40.2

hearts pure. Yesterday we talked about modesty and how we need to keep certain parts of our body

0:48.4

veiled as respect for the wonderful loving God that created us. Today we are going to be talking about our eyes.

0:57.6

Now, that might seem like a funny thing to talk about this week when we're talking about purity,

1:02.4

but we need to remember that our eyes are like the windows to the soul.

1:08.5

Many philosophers have saints and have described it that way. And a lot of the times,

1:13.3

the things that we see, the things we allow our eyes to take in, can play a big impact on our purity.

1:24.3

And like we said, the things that we see and take in can stain that beautiful baptismal

1:31.9

gown that we had on our baptism. So we need to protect and really guard our eyes. Now, the

1:41.6

unfortunate truth is that in this world, there are lots of bad things that we can look at and that we can allow our eyes to take in.

1:53.5

Most of these things are pictures or videos.

1:57.9

And there can be lots of different ways that they can be bad. They can be overly

2:02.6

violent. They can use language that are not appropriate. We can watch people acting in horrible ways.

2:10.4

Or we can watch people that are not practicing modesty. Chances are your teachers and parents are watching out for you and only showing you

2:20.4

things that are good and pure and will lead to your holiness. But my friends, you will come to a day

2:27.3

where you get to make these decisions for yourself, where you get to decide what you are going to watch when you turn on Netflix,

2:37.6

where you get to decide what types of magazines you will pick up, and what sort of things you

2:42.9

will allow your eyes to take in. And in the world that we live in, there is a lot of temptation.
